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

78 lines
1.5 KiB

  1. MAJORCOMP=ntos
  2. MINORCOMP=dd
  3. TARGETNAME=RDPDD
  4. TARGETPATH=obj
  5. TARGETTYPE=GDI_DRIVER
  6. ALT_PROJECT=HYDRA
  7. ALT_PROJECT_TARGET=.
  8. SIGNMODULE_CMD=CERTADD
  9. C_DEFINES=$(C_DEFINES) -DUNICODE -DOS_WINNT -DTRC_COMPILE_LEVEL=0 -DDLL_DISP -DINC_SCH\
  10. -DNODEFAULTLIB -DDC_HICOLOR -DDRAW_NINEGRID -DDRAW_GDIPLUS $(DDINT3)
  11. !if $(386)
  12. C_DEFINES=$(C_DEFINES) -DV1_COMPRESSION
  13. !endif
  14. !if "$(FREEBUILD)" == "1"
  15. MSC_OPTIMIZATION=/Oxs
  16. !if "$(BUILD_PRF)"=="1"
  17. C_DEFINES=$(C_DEFINES) -DTRC_COMPILE_LEVEL=5
  18. !else
  19. C_DEFINES=$(C_DEFINES) -DDC_NO_PERFORMANCE_MONITOR -DTRC_COMPILE_LEVEL=5
  20. !endif
  21. !else
  22. MSC_OPTIMIZATION=/Odi
  23. C_DEFINES=$(C_DEFINES) -DTRC_COMPILE_LEVEL=2 -DDC_DEBUG \
  24. -DDC_NO_PERFORMANCE_MONITOR
  25. !endif
  26. USE_LIBCNTPR_FOR_GDI_DRIVER_CRTS=1
  27. INCLUDES = \
  28. ..\inc; \
  29. ..\..\inc; \
  30. ..\..\..\inc; \
  31. $(DS_INC_PATH)\crypto; \
  32. $(DDK_INC_PATH)
  33. DLLDEF=disp.def
  34. BBTCOMP=1
  35. DLLORDER=$(TARGETNAME).prf
  36. PRECOMPILED_INCLUDE=precmpdd.h
  37. PRECOMPILED_PCH=precmpdd.pch
  38. PRECOMPILED_OBJ=precmpdd.obj
  39. MSC_WARNING_LEVEL=/W3 /WX
  40. SOURCES=\
  41. nschdisp.c \
  42. nddapi.c \
  43. nddint.c \
  44. nbadisp.c \
  45. noeapi.c \
  46. noeint.c \
  47. npmdisp.c \
  48. ncmapi.c \
  49. ntrcdisp.c \
  50. noadisp.c \
  51. nssidisp.c \
  52. nchdisp.c \
  53. nsbcdisp.c \
  54. nbcdisp.c \
  55. nshmdisp.c \
  56. color.c \
  57. oe2.c \
  58. tsharedd.rc